Overview of Bellwald, Goms and Wallis (Valais) as a vacation rental destination

Bellwald is part of the Goms district in the canton of Wallis, a cantonal region known for some of Switzerland’s most reliable sunshine and dramatic mountain scenery. In winter, Bellwald becomes a snow‑globe of ski runs, toboggan runs, and glistening avalanches of fresh snow; in summer, the valley opens with wildflower meadows, glacier views, and long hiking routes. For the visitor seeking a “home away from home,” the area offers a broad spectrum of vacation rentals, holiday rentals, and house accommodations—from modern apartments with high‑speed wifi to traditional chalets that exude alpine charm. The region is also well connected for travelers who want to combine a work stint with excursions to nearby attractions such as the Aletsch Glacier, the largest glacier in the Alps, and the villages of the Aletsch Arena, including Bettmeralp and Riederalp, which are popular day trips for outdoor enthusiasts. Getting there, getting around and practical tips for remote work

Bellwald and the Goms region are well suited to travelers who plan multi‑stop itineraries. If you’re arriving from major Swiss cities or neighboring countries, the typical route is to take a train to Brig or Fiesch, then a bus or cable‑car connection to Bellwald. If you’re driving, the valley road network offers a scenic route through the region, though traffic patterns can vary with winter weather.
